Abstract

The invention relates to digital video eye dynamic analyzer. It comprises video input, image gathering card, microprocessor and display. It uses machine visual technique to identify the eye moving track with eye moving image gathering, digital image process and analysis, and storage display. The analyzer is contact free without any damage, digitalized, tunable gathering cycle, timely on line automatic tracking the movement of the iris with authentic colorful image. It can be widely applied in biology, animal, medicine, and so on for human being and animal psychological and behavior analysis, also used in clinical diagnostics.

Below in conjunction with accompanying drawing and to analyze the monkey eye movement is that the invention will be further described for example:
Digital video eye motion analyzer is made up of video input unit (1), image pick-up card (2), microprocessor (3) and display screen (4).Video input unit (1) can be the normal component that the video camera of standard speed or non-standard rate maybe can obtain image.Video input unit (1) is installed on the straight-arm that protracts with the similar clamp ring of headphone, is worn on the tested monkey head, aim at tested monkey eyes, this clamp ring can not damage any position of monkey head or health.Video input unit (1) is sent to image pick-up card (2) with the analog or digital image of monkey eyes by cable or data bus, image pick-up card is sent to microprocessor (3) by data bus with digital picture, the monkey eye image is treated in microprocessor (3) to obtain current monkey eye movement figure and eye movement changing trend diagram with analysis, and eye movement figure, eye movement changing trend diagram and eye image can be stored in the microprocessor (3) and can go up demonstration or carry out remote transmission by the built-in communication port of microprocessor (3) at display screen (4) simultaneously.Video input unit of the present invention (1), image pick-up card (2), microprocessor (3), display screen (4) all are the normal component that can directly purchase.
